#60247A Color
#60247A is rgb(96, 36, 122) in RGB, hsl(282, 54%, 31%) in HSL, and about cmyk(21%, 70%, 0%, 52%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Eminence (#6C3082),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.13.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#60247A Channel Values
How #60247A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 96 · G 36 · B 122 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 282° · S 54% · L 31%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 282° · S 70% · V 48%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 21% · M 70% · Y 0% · K 52%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.34:1 vs white · 2.03: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#60247A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#60247A?
#60247A is a dark purple — rgb(96, 36, 122) in RGB and hsl(282, 54%, 31%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Eminence (#6C3082),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.13.
What is the RGB value of #60247A?
#60247A is rgb(96, 36, 122) — red 96, green 36, and blue 122 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#60247A?
#60247A converts to approximately cmyk(21%, 70%, 0%, 52%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#60247A be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#60247A scores 10.34:1 against white and 2.03: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#60247A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#60247A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is rebeccapurple (#663399) at a CIE76 distance of 11.66, which is visibly different.
